Transaction ac29bea9062e1409fc476d6aac72644e91ccabf5337099462fe9be17fa50fbd0
1 Input
1 Output
-
ac29bea9062e1409fc476d6aac72644e91ccabf5337099462fe9be17fa50fbd0:0
- value
- 158385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d205db9aec75699bac8cacafef1623e89ee7b87 OP_EQUAL
- address
- 3EZDyRq6QikNMxdDxbwZwZnKqX74jjbNve